Wycombe v Chesterfield preview

Team news ahead of Saturday's League Two clash between Wycombe and Chesterfield at Adams Park.

Wycombe's injury problems are continuing to clear up as they look to bounce back from the 1-0 defeat to Exeter.

That home loss saw Charles Dunne (foot) return to the squad along with Dave Winfield and Dean Morgan (both hamstring) as their terrible injury list begins to shorten.

Morgan, who signed a contract until the end of the season on Thursday, could be handed a start but fellow striker Ade Azeez has returned to parent club Charlton.

The 18-year-old made five appearances during a month-long loan spell and despite player-manager Gareth Ainsworth wanting to keep him Azeez has returned to The Valley.

Midfielder Josh Scowen (hamstring) is unlikely to return but Leon Johnson is back in training and could be named in the squad while Ainsworth will have to decide whether to include himself in the 18.

Other options include QPR loanee Michael Harriman who made his debut against the Grecians but Danny Foster, Matt Bloomfield and Gary Doherty remain on the sidelines.

Chesterfield remain without the suspended Conor Townsend.

The on-loan defender serves the second game of a three-match ban following his red card against Morecambe.

Defender Terrell Forbes, striker Scott Boden and winger Jack Waddle have all been placed on the transfer list and are not expected to be involved.

Cook has no fresh injury concerns for the fixture but is expected to make changes following the 1-0 defeat at Accrington on New Year's Day.

Jack Lester and Marc Richards were paired in a front two at the Crown Ground but Cook could revert to playing one striker while midfielder Dan Whitaker may be recalled to the starting XI.

The Spireites have won just one of their last five matches and are four points off the play-off places.
